Responsibilities:


  • Hands-on lab support and process development for the chemical synthesis and downstream processing of oligonucleotide-based drug substance
  • Synthesis of oligonucleotides up to 11 mmol scale
  • Downstream processing of oligonucleotides including prep-HPLC, Ultrafiltration, annealing, concentration and Lyophilization
  • In process analytical testing including AX-HPLC, IPRP-HPLC, LCMS, UV-vis
  • Technical support for optimization of contract manufacturing processes



Skills or Requirements:

  • Basic understanding of analytical techniques (pH, osmolality, conductivity measurement, HPLC, LC-MS etc.).
  • Related hands-on experience is preferred. Knowledge of oligonucleotide manufacture process including phosphoramidite chemistry, chromatography, ultrafiltration etc. is a plus.
